Language change icon for desktop
English  |  Dutch  |  French
Technology Senior Java/Spark Developer Irving, TX, USA
Job Description

Synechron Inc is seeking Senior Java/Spark Developer within financial services.

Job Purpose
  • The primary purpose of this role is to develop features using Java and Spark for Product Control application.
Job Background/context
  • Requirement is for a Senior Java Developer with a proven track record of producing complex software solutions.
  • This role will require extensive development using Java, Spark, Big Data technologies.
  • Candidate will be heavily involved with implementation of end to end solutions for various regulatory projects related to operation risk, P&L, PAA for all various financial products.
  • Candidate will be involved with critical regulatory projects with aggressive timelines and will work extensively in redesigning data model of existing platform and maintain it going forward.
  • Coach offshore development teams effectively for optimum productivity.
  • Understanding Business Requirements and Functional Requirements provided by Business Analysts and to convert into Technical Design Documents and ability to develop solutions as per requirements.
  • Design and build scalable infrastructure and platform to ingest, store and process very large amount of data.
  • Leverage industry-standard data orchestration and automation tools to create efficient and reliable ETL jobs.
  • Build best in class ETL based solutions for effective data ingestion and transformation.
  • Gathering requirements for new functionality from business users; offering timely solutions; developing, testing and implementing the proposed solutions.
  • Collaborate with various data source teams on effective strategies for data ingestion.
  • Work closely with the IT and platform teams to deliver tech solutions.
  • Be an expert in all things data wrangling, aggregation, summarization and analysis.
  • Explore existing application systems, determines areas of complexity, potential risks to successful implementation.
  • Bachelor of Science or Master degree in Computer Science or Engineering or related discipline; Master's degree preferred
  • 5+ years’ experience in software development using Core Java
  • 3+ years' experience in technologies (Hadoop, Spark and Big Data platforms, RBDMS, NoSQL)
  • Advanced SQL capabilities are required. Knowledge of database design techniques and experience working with extremely large data volumes is a plus
  • Advanced experience in ETL and data wrangling using language Java
  • Experience in other technologies such as HIVE, Kafka, TIBCO EMS, GemFire, Spring, etc.
  • Experience in programing in Linux/Unix environment including shell scripting
  • Experience in Agile SDLC, JIRA, BitBucket/Git, AWS ECS, RedShift is a plus
  • Ability to work in a fast-paced environment both as an individual contributor and a tech lead
  • Experience in implementing successful projects
  • Ability to adjust priorities quickly as circumstances dictate
  • Consistently demonstrates clear and concise written and verbal communication
We'd love to see
  • Experience with large database and DW implementation in language Java.
  • Experience working in Big Data platform with technologies, especially Hadoop, Spark, Kafka, and HIVE.
  • Understanding of VLDB performance aspects, such as table partitioning, shard, table distribution and optimization techniques.
  • Programming experience, including Java, Spring, ksh.

Share this job

Are you legally authorized to work in the United States on a full-time, regular basis?
Will you now, or in the future, require sponsorship for employment visa status (e.g. H-1B visa status)?
Are you ready to relocate for the job in the United States?
First Name
Last Name
Contact Number
One file only.
100 MB limit.
Allowed types: pdf doc docx.
Enter the characters shown in the image.


Synechron, Inc. and/or its affiliates and group companies takes your privacy seriously. By providing your information, you are signing up to receive information about Synechron services and related marketing. Your personal data will be protected in accordance with Synechron's Privacy Policy. By filling out this form, you are giving Synechron your consent so that we may communicate relevant information to you via email, telephone, invitations, and other digital notifications. If at any time you would like to withdraw your consent or update your profile and preferences, you can do so by clicking here or by contacting us directly.